Webb4 maj 2024 · Ordinarily, however, a corporation’s board of directors has the authority to bring lawsuits on the company’s behalf, for the benefit of all of the shareholders. Thus, a shareholder who wants the company to pursue claims must first make a demand upon the board to file a lawsuit, unless such a demand would be futile. Webb14 juni 2024 · Derivative Lawsuits. If the shareholders of a corporation are concerned about the action of corporate officers or directors, they can bring what is known as a “derivative lawsuit.” A derivative lawsuit is an action brought on behalf of the corporation and generally alleges a breach of fiduciary duty, discussed in more detail below.
